Delicate Cognitive Impairment: The center Floor
Mild Cognitive Impairment occupies a space involving the expected cognitive adjustments of usual aging and the more critical drop of dementia. Think of it as being a gray zone – visible variations that don't considerably interfere with everyday life.
When you've got MCI, you may struggle to recollect modern discussions or appointments. Potentially you find it tougher for making conclusions or Adhere to the plot of a movie. Relations may possibly detect these variations, but generally, you'll be able to nevertheless control your finances, get your drugs, put together meals, and keep your residence.
What will make MCI unique from ordinary getting old would be that the improvements are increased than predicted for someone of your age and education amount. On the other hand, compared with Alzheimer's disease, these changes don't very seriously compromise your independence or skill to function in daily activities.
The various Faces of MCI
Not all Delicate Cognitive Impairment is the same. Doctors figure out differing types depending on which considering competencies are influenced:
Amnestic MCI mainly has an effect on memory. You would possibly overlook essential gatherings, conversations, or appointments that you should Formerly have remembered.
Non-amnestic MCI affects imagining expertise in addition to memory. You might have difficulties with planning, organizing, generating seem judgments, or navigating familiar areas.
A lot of people experience several sorts of MCI, affecting both equally memory as well as other cognitive features. The particular sample can offer clues about the underlying trigger and if the affliction could possibly development to dementia.
Alzheimer's Illness: When Cognitive Modifications Disrupt Everyday life
Alzheimer's disorder is the commonest method of dementia, accounting for sixty-eighty% of conditions. In contrast to MCI, Alzheimer's substantially interferes with each day functioning and independence.
Within the early phases of Alzheimer's, memory troubles will often be more pronounced than with MCI. You may repeat inquiries, wander away in common sites, or have trouble handling cash and paying out charges. As being the sickness progresses, modifications in persona and habits may well acquire. You may perhaps come to be confused, suspicious, or withdrawn, and also have problems with language, difficulty-fixing, and acquainted jobs.
What distinguishes Alzheimer's from MCI would be the effect on lifestyle. With Alzheimer's, cognitive modifications ultimately make it tricky to take care of independently, and help becomes needed for routines which were after schedule.
The Science At the rear of the Signs or symptoms
The two conditions entail modifications from the brain, but to distinctive degrees.
In MCI, Mind scans may exhibit gentle shrinkage in memory facilities just like the hippocampus. There might be little accumulations of irregular proteins called amyloid plaques and tau tangles – the hallmarks of Alzheimer's ailment – but in smaller amounts.
In Alzheimer's disease, these brain improvements are more prevalent and intense. The plaques and tangles spread all over the Mind, disrupting communication involving neurons and ultimately resulting in mobile death. The Development Dilemma: Will MCI Result in Alzheimer's?
The most popular questions about MCI is whether it's going to development to Alzheimer's sickness. The solution isn't simple.
Some individuals with MCI continue being secure for years without having important worsening. Some others may even see their signs and symptoms boost, particularly if their cognitive alterations ended up a result of medication Unwanted side effects, sleep issues, or mood Problems that may be handled.
Nonetheless, analysis suggests that about 10-fifteen% of those with MCI go on to acquire dementia yearly, as compared to one-2% of the general older Grownup populace. In excess of a span of five years, about 30-fifty% of individuals with MCI may possibly progress to Alzheimer's illness or another method of dementia.
Sure components may well raise the danger of progression. These involve obtaining the amnestic kind of MCI, carrying particular genetic variants much like the APOE e4 gene, displaying particular styles on brain scans, or owning irregular levels of sure proteins in spinal fluid.
Dealing with Memory Concerns: Distinctive Ways for Different Ailments
The remedy approaches for MCI and Alzheimer's ailment reflect their discrepancies in severity and effect.
For MCI, there are at this time no medicines precisely accredited for treatment. As a substitute, management focuses on addressing hazard aspects Which may worsen cognitive perform, for instance large hypertension, diabetic issues, large cholesterol, despair, sleep Ailments, and drugs Negative effects.
Way of living interventions Perform a vital job in MCI management. Typical Actual physical exercise, cognitive stimulation, social engagement, a Mediterranean-design eating plan, and proper management of other overall health disorders might support retain cognitive function and probably sluggish development.
For Alzheimer's disorder, treatment consists of drugs that will briefly make improvements to symptoms or slow illness progression. These contain cholinesterase inhibitors (like donepezil, rivastigmine, and galantamine) and memantine. Even though these prescription drugs You should not stop the underlying Mind changes, they are able to assist keep operate and quality of life for the stretch of time.
As Alzheimer's advancements, treatment method ever more concentrates on taking care of behavioral indicators and delivering acceptable care and assistance to maintain dignity and Standard of living.
